One of the best options to get yourself back into your workout routine after having a baby is a jogging stroller. Jogging strollers usually have larger wheels than normal strollers and sometimes have three wheels instead of four. The design of these wheels keeps the stroller stable while you are jogging behind. With a jogging stroller you can start jogging as soon as your baby can hold his head up. This means you can get back in shape before your baby turns one!

A quality jogging stroller will have a fixed front wheel. Traditional strollers and some models of jogging strollers have front wheels that swivel. A swivel wheeled stroller does not work well for jogging, because the stroller can veer off track. Also, a fixed front wheel will not jar your baby as much as a swivel front wheel if you should hit a bump on the road.

Jogging strollers come with either aluminum alloy or steel wheels. Alloy wheels costs a little more than steel, but they will not rust. This makes alloy wheels a necessity for those moms in areas that have frequent rains or snow. Another benefit of alloy wheels is that they are lighter than steel wheels, making your jog easier.

If you intend to jog while your baby is still an infant you want to buy a stroller with a reclining seat. The motion your baby will experience while out in the jogging stroller will probably soothe him and put him to sleep. A reclining seat will help him to stay comfortable. Be sure that the straps are secure and will keep your baby in place while you continue to jog.
